哈喽,大家好,我是木头左!
在本文中,将深入探讨PostgreSQL数据库中的一个强大功能,即如何轻松修改字段名称。无论你是一个新手开发者,还是一个经验丰富的DBA,这篇文章都将为你提供实用的技巧和建议。
在开发过程中,经常会遇到需要修改表结构的情况,比如添加新的字段、删除旧的字段、修改字段名称等。修改字段名称是其中一项常见的操作,但也是容易被忽视的一项。那么,为什么需要修改字段名称呢?
接下来,将详细介绍如何在PostgreSQL中修改字段名称。将使用ALTER TABLE
语句来完成这个任务。
ALTER TABLE
语句修改字段名称要修改字段名称,可以使用ALTER TABLE
语句中的RENAME COLUMN
子句。下面是一个简单的示例:
ALTER TABLE table_name RENAME COLUMN old_column_name TO new_column_name;
在这个示例中,table_name
是要修改的表的名称,old_column_name
是当前字段的名称,new_column_name
是要将字段名称修改为的新名称。
在某些情况下,可能需要修改多级列名。这时,可以使用双引号将列名括起来。例如:
ALTER TABLE table_name RENAME COLUMN "level1.level2.column_name" TO "new_column_name";
如果的表中有函数列(即某个列的值是一个函数的结果),也可以修改其列名。这可以通过以下方式实现:
ALTER TABLE table_name RENAME COLUMN function_column_name TO new_function_column_name;
在修改字段名称时,需要注意以下几点:
ALTER TABLE
语句之前,应该先备份数据,以防止在修改过程中发生数据丢失。 本文详细介绍了如何在PostgreSQL中修改字段名称。希望这些技巧和建议能够帮助你在实际工作中更加高效地完成这项任务。同时,也期待在未来的文章中学到更多有关PostgreSQL的技巧和最佳实践。如果你有任何问题或建议,欢迎在评论区留言讨论!
我是木头左,感谢各位童鞋的点赞、收藏,我们下期更精彩!
原创声明:本文系作者授权腾讯云开发者社区发表,未经许可,不得转载。
如有侵权,请联系 cloudcommunity@tencent.com 删除。
原创声明:本文系作者授权腾讯云开发者社区发表,未经许可,不得转载。
如有侵权,请联系 cloudcommunity@tencent.com 删除。